Stainless steel Y-shaped filter
By introducing buffering and cleaning components into the stainless steel Y-type filter, the problem of device damage caused by water flow impact is solved, extending service life and improving filtration efficiency.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of filter technology, and in particular to a stainless steel Y-type filter. Background Technology
[0002] Stainless steel Y-type filters are a common type of pipeline filtration equipment, primarily used to remove solid particles from fluids and protect downstream equipment from contamination or damage. Their name comes from their Y-shaped design. They are characterized by simple structure, easy installation, and excellent filtration efficiency, and are widely used in industries such as petroleum, chemical, water treatment, food, and pharmaceuticals.
[0003] When existing devices are in use, the water flow directly impacts the device. Over time, the device will suffer some damage due to the impact, thus affecting the filtration effect. Therefore, a stainless steel Y-type filter is proposed. Utility Model Content
[0004] (a) Technical problems to be solved
[0005]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a stainless steel Y-type filter to solve the problem mentioned in the background art that when the existing device is used, the water flow directly impacts the device, and after long-term use, the device will suffer certain fixed damage due to the impact, thereby affecting the filtration effect of the device.
[0006] (II) Technical Solution
[0007]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a stainless steel Y-type filter, comprising a filter tube, a filter cylinder fixedly connected inside the filter tube, a cleaning assembly inside the filter cylinder, a water inlet pipe fixedly connected to one end of the filter tube, and several sets of buffer assemblies inside the water inlet pipe. The cleaning assembly includes two sets of cleaning rods disposed inside the filter cylinder, a mounting plate fixedly connected to one side of each of the two sets of cleaning rods, and a servo motor fixedly connected to one end of the mounting plate. Each of the several sets of buffer assemblies includes several sets of buffer plates disposed inside the water inlet pipe, fixing rods fixedly connected to both sides of each of the several sets of buffer plates, and a torque spring sleeved on the outer side of each of the two sets of fixing rods.
[0008] As a further embodiment of this utility model, connecting plates are fixedly connected to both sides of the filter tube. Threaded holes are opened inside both sets of connecting plates, and bolts are threaded into the inside of both sets of threaded holes. The bolts serve to fix the fixing plates.
[0009] As a further embodiment of this utility model, both sets of bolts are threaded with fixing plates on their outer sides, and one end of both sets of bolts is threaded with a nut. The fixing plates serve to fix the sealing plate.
[0010] As a further embodiment of this utility model, a sealing plate is fixedly connected to one side of each of the two sets of fixing plates, and a motor housing is fixedly connected to one end of the sealing plate. The motor housing serves to store the servo motor.
[0011] As a further embodiment of this utility model, one end of the water inlet pipe is fixedly connected to a first flange, and the surface of the first flange is provided with mounting screw holes. The first flange serves to connect to the external pipeline.
[0012] As a further embodiment of this utility model, a water outlet pipe is fixedly connected to one side of the filter tube, and a label plate is fixedly connected to the surface of the filter tube. The water outlet pipe serves to discharge the filtered liquid.
[0013] As a further embodiment of this utility model, a second flange is fixedly connected to one end of the water outlet pipe. The surface of the second flange is provided with several sets of fixing screw holes. The second flange serves to connect to the external drain pipe.
[0014] (III) Beneficial Effects
[0015] This utility model provides a stainless steel Y-type filter, which has the following beneficial effects:
[0016] 1. This stainless steel Y-type filter, through the setting of the buffer component, connects the inlet pipe to the external pipeline during use, and the external water flows into the device. At this time, the water flow hits the buffer plate, the buffer plate drives the fixed rod to rotate, and the torque spring generates torque force to drive it to reset. It can play a buffering role during use, reduce the impact force of liquid on the device, prevent the device from being damaged by excessive impact force, and extend the service life of the device.
[0017] 2. This stainless steel Y-type filter, through the setting of the cleaning component, when in use, the servo motor is started, the servo motor rotates and drives the mounting plate to rotate, the mounting plate rotates and the cleaning rod rotates, the cleaning rod rotates and cleans the filter cartridge, thereby keeping the filter cartridge clean and tidy, avoiding excessive impurities sticking to the filter cartridge and affecting the filtration effect of the device. [0031] In this invention, the working steps of the device are as follows:
[0032] First step: When in use, connect the water inlet pipe 4 to the external pipe, and the external water flow enters the device. At this time, the water flow hits the buffer plate 501, and the buffer plate 501 drives the fixed rod 502 to rotate. The torque spring 503 generates torque force to drive it to reset. It can play a buffering role during use and reduce the impact of liquid on the device.
[0033] The second step: When in use, start the servo motor 303. The servo motor 303 rotates and drives the mounting plate 302 to rotate. The mounting plate 302 rotates to the cleaning rod 301, and the cleaning rod 301 rotates to clean the filter cartridge 2, thereby keeping the filter cartridge 2 clean and tidy.
